Discord Bot Faucet

This is a Discord Bot that dispenses Testnet ETH written in TypeScript.

Setup

Change the example.config.json into config.json, and fill in the required fields.

Create a file called .env and paste in the following lines. Make sure to fill it out with your details

WALLET_PRIVATE_KEY="<wallet-private-key>"
BOT_TOKEN="<bot-token>"
DB_USERNAME="<username>"
DB_PASSWORD="<password>"

Installation

  1. If you do not have pnpm, run npm i -g pnpm.

  2. Install Dependancies using pnpm install.

Optionally you can update the dependancies using pnpm update.

  1. Fill in the config and run the bot : pnpm start:dev

Adding Networks or Tokens

Adding Networks or Tokens are fairly straighforward.

  1. Open up the config.json.
  2. Add a network Object in the networks field ex :
    {
     "name": "networkName",
     "nativeCurrency": "kool",
     "ALCHEMY_URL": "https://rpc-url/xxx",
     "scan": "https://myscan.kool.io/tx/"
    }
  3. That's literally it!

Database

This BOT currently has two modes it can run, KeyV - Memory and Postgres - Storage. You can change the mode by changing the database value in the stats field of config.json like so :

Storage Mode

"database": "pg",

This sets the BOT to use storage - Postgres DB. Make sure you setup the necessary database parameters

Memory Mode

"database": "keyv",

This sets the BOT to use memory - KeyV. Use this if you want to just use the BOT without having to configure Databases. In addition, this is the default if no parameter was set into database.
